Barbie fishing rod reels in record-setting catfish is the title and it starts like this:
David Hayes doesn’t usually fish with a pink Barbie rod and reel, but when his 3-year-old granddaughter Alyssa handed him her fishing pole, he used it to haul in a state record channel catfish.
While it might be a bit embarrassing for a grown man to admit using Barbie equipment, there was nothing shabby in the prize that pink pole landed.
Excerpt:
At 32 inches long and 22 1/2 inches around, the fish was 2 inches longer than the fishing rod. Hayes was trying to land the 21-pound fish on a 6-pound test line.
